AAR and Woodward Sign Multi-year Commercial Distribution Agreement

by BDI Editorial Staff

AAR CORP., a leading provider of aviation services to commercial and government operators, MROs, and OEMs, has signed a multi-year commercial distribution agreement with Woodward, a world leader in the design and manufacture of aerospace and industrial controls.

Under the agreement, AAR will serve as the preferred distributor of Woodward high-demand consumable parts — including fuel filters, gaskets, and seals — for the CFM LEAP, GEnx, and CF34 engines, direct to commercial airlines. These parts are critical to ensuring optimal engine performance and reliability and represent some of the highest-demand components in commercial aviation today.

This agreement expands an existing relationship. AAR has distributed Woodward parts to the defense market, and this new agreement extends that proven channel into commercial aviation. For customers, this means direct access to Woodward components through AAR’s global warehouse network, with faster delivery and reliable support, including in Aircraft on Ground (AOG) situations.
